OPEN the tailgate and you're presented with a large, deep and flat luggage area that extends all the way to the front seats when the 60/40 split-fold is employed. The three rear headrests must unfortunately be removed (and stowed) to enable the seatback to fold down fully, but the rear seat cushions tumble forward neatly against the front pews to allow the seatback to sit flat. The luggage compartment is fully lined and has four tie-down anchorage points. A 12-volt power outlet is useful for items like a portable air compressor. Golf can hold up to 650 litres of luggage when the rear bench seat is upright.
